Data Center Technician 4
Oracle is a world leader in cloud solutions, dedicated to tackling today’s challenges with innovative technology. The Data Center Technician will be responsible for delivering core infrastructure and foundational technologies within the OCI data center environments, performing repairs, installations, and monitoring of data center systems.

Responsibilities
Show professionalism on your daily data center routine activities for a shift in a 24/7/365 working environment
Be able to work on a shift schedule that rotates (4 days a week of 10-hour shifts). Includes weekends and holidays
Be punctual in arriving for shifts on time and provide proper handover reports after shift to the next team member(s)
Receive/ship data center equipment as needed
Install, Remove, Troubleshoot hardware in data centers racks without disturbing other hardware and critical infrastructure on site
Maintain asset inventory and update internal application as needed
Be accessible via cell phone and willing to work on onsite emergency as needed
Participate and complete training that aligns with corporate objectives to bridge skill gaps and learn new relevant technologies
Act within Service Level Agreements (SLA) on the tickets assigned to you in your space
Qualification
Required
Knowledge of server/storage/network hardware
Excellent time management skills
Detail-oriented with excellent organizational skills
Be a good team player
Strong interest in learning new DC concepts
Dependable and trustworthy
Process oriented
Must be able to lift 75 lbs
Strong verbal and written communication skills
High School Diploma
3+ years working in an Data Center environment
Troubleshooting Experience on servers, networking devices and IT equipment
Inventory management experience. Ordering, receiving and shipping server parts
Ability to prioritize work based on business needs and urgency
Ability to communicate and write effectively in both verbal and written communication mediums
Experience taking on-call shifts and ability to respond to critical events as needed
Experience escalating issues to Sr. onsite staff and management as needed
Training and developing team members
Developing documentation and solutions to technical issues and training team members on them
Directing and managing workload for a medium to large size team of Data Center Technicians
IT Hardware Concepts knowledge: RAID, SAN, X86 Architecture, SCIS, Linux/Unix, Boot Process, GRUB/LILO, File Systems, Network Device configuration, Directory Structure
Preferred
2-year or 4-year degree or relevant work experience
5+ Years of Data Center Experience
Linux administration knowledge/Ability to run Linux commands
Data center networking knowledge
Experience in Data Center Infrastructure projects
1 year+ experience in Structured Cabling Copper/Fiber and testing of cables
1 year+ experience in Cooling and Electrical systems concepts inside the data center
Experience in repairing and working on Sun servers is nice to have but not required
